Alexandru Dimca

From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Romanian mathematician

Alexandru Dimca is a Romanian mathematician, who works in algebraic geometry at University of Nice Sophia Antipolis.

Education and career

[edit ]

Dimca competed in the International Mathematical Olympiad in 1970, 1971, and 1972, earning two bronze medals and one silver medal.[1] He obtained his PhD in 1981 from the University of Bucharest; his thesis "Stable mappings and singularities", was written under the direction of Gheorghe Galbură.[2] His Google Scholar h-index is 24.

Dimca is a distinguished mathematician in algebra, geometry and topology.[3] He has written three important books in this field: Sheaves in Topology, Singularities and Topology of Hypersurfaces and Topics on real and complex singularities.

Honors

[edit ]

He received a Doctor Honoris Causa of Ovidius University.[4]
